CISA Adds One Known Exploited Vulnerability to Catalog

CISA has added one new vulnerability to its Known Exploited Vulnerabilities (KEV) Catalog, based on evidence of active exploitation. CVE-2026-42897 Microsoft Exchange Server Cross-Site Scripting Vulnerability This type of vulnerability is a frequent attack vector for malicious cyber actors and poses significant risks to the federal enterprise. CVE-2026-20182: Cisco Catalyst SD-WAN Auth Bypass Added to CISA KEV

CVE-2026-20182: Cisco Catalyst SD-WAN Auth Bypass Added to CISA KEV Cisco has disclosed CVE-2026-20182, a critical authentication bypass affecting Cisco Catalyst SD-WAN Controller (formerly vSmart) and Cisco Catalyst SD-WAN Manager (formerly vManage).
